Abstract
A non-woven fabric includes flame retardant fibers and binding material mixed with the flame retardant fibers. The binding material sets a thickness of the fabric. Application of a flame to the fabric causes the binding material to degrade and the flame retardant fibers to expand to prevent a flame from passing through a hole in a wall of an appliance, a building, or an appliance and/or to protect wiring of an appliance, a building, or an appliance.

15. A clothes dryer comprising:
-
a cabinet that houses a front bulkhead, a rear bulkhead, and a drum positioned between the front bulkhead and the rear bulkhead; a wiring harness secured to one or more of the cabinet, front bulkhead, and rear bulkhead; wherein a flame is provided in the drum during a fire test; a heat shield positioned to prevent burning of the wiring harness during the fire test; wherein the heat shield comprises; flame retardant fibers; binding material mixed with the flame retardant fibers; wherein the binding material sets a thickness of the fabric; wherein application of a 1000°
F. flame to the fabric causes the binding material to degrade and the flame retardant fibers to expand such that a thickness of the flame retardant fabric increases by a factor of at least two. - View Dependent Claims (16, 17, 18, 19, 20, 21)

22. An electrical assembly comprising:
-
an electrical box having walls and at least one knockout for forming a wiring opening; a flame retardant pad disposed in the electrical box; at least one wire that extends through the wiring opening and through the flame retardant pad; wherein the flame retardant pad comprises; flame retardant fibers; binding material mixed with the flame retardant fibers; wherein the binding material sets a thickness of the fabric; wherein application of a 1000°
F. flame to the fabric causes the binding material to degrade and the flame retardant fibers to expand such that the flame retardant fabric prevents a flame inside the electrical box from passing through the wiring opening.
